University College London and University of Illinois at Chicago researchers report a new, scalable method for making a material that can reversibly store magnesium ions at high-voltage. The study is published RSC journal Nanoscale.

When you raise or take your foot off the accelerator in an EV the regenerative braking will start to slow the car down before you touch the brake pedal, and harvests the energy from doing so, storing it in your electric car’s (or van’s) battery. Myth #2: Hydrogen gas is dangerous to store and use. One of the most common arguments heard when discussing the use of hydrogen is that, as a flammable gas, it is easily ignited and therefore far too dangerous to be stored either in refueling stations or within a pressure tank.
